Saturday Family Workshop


Celebrate National Colouring Day by colouring the world in sustainable hues. Inspired by the whimsical spirit of the Moomins and their deep bond with nature, this workshop invites families to make fortune teller puppets that reimagineingMoomin characters as garden creatures or mythical beasts. Using botanical inks made from plants, participants will fill their creations with vibrant natural colours while reflecting on how ancient traditions of pigment-making can inspire eco-friendly choices today.
